What Is a Knipex Wire Stripper?
A Knipex Wire Stripper is a specialised hand tool used to remove insulation from electrical wires without harming the metal conductor underneath. Unlike basic cutters or makeshift tools, it is built for accuracy and repeatable results.
This matters because the exposed conductor must remain in good condition for the next step of the job. Once stripped correctly, the wire can be fitted into connectors, terminals, or crimp points with greater confidence. That improves both electrical performance and overall installation quality.
Why Proper Wire Stripping Matters
Every reliable electrical connection starts with good wire preparation. When insulation is stripped correctly, the conductor remains intact and ready for safe termination. On the other hand, poor stripping can weaken the wire and affect conductivity.

Tips for Getting the Best Results
To make the most of a Knipex Wire Stripper, it helps to follow good working habits:
select the correct wire size before use
strip only the necessary insulation length
check the conductor after each strip
keep the tool clean after regular use
store it properly with other tools
avoid using it for tasks outside its purpose
These habits support longer tool life and more consistent performance over time.
